Zusammenfassung
Es wird eine parallele Version des Karamarkar Verfahrens zur Linearen Programmierung dargestellt, die auf einem Multicluster 2 implementiert wurde. Der Hauptaufwand liegt dabei in der Lösung eines Gleichungssystems der Form ADA T * x = 6, was mit einer Cholesky-Zerlegung für dünnbesetzte Matrizen erfolgt. Die Faktorisierung von à = ADA T füllt bis zu 98% der Laufzeit aus. Sie wurde mit einem Fan-In Algorithmus auf 2, 4 und 8 Worker Prozessoren verteilt. Um eine gleichmäßige Lcistverteilung zu erreichen, ist ein Mapping-Verfahren installiert worden, welches die Struktur des Cholesky-Faktors graphentheoretisch analysiert. Darüberhinaus wird die Berechnung von A ebenfalls parallelisiert.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Literaturverzeichnis
C. Ashcraft, S.C. Eisenstat und J.W-H Liu, ’A Fan—In Algorithm For Distributed Sparse numerical Factorization’, in: SIAM J. Sci. Stat. Comput., Vol.11, No.3, Mai 1990, S.593–599.
G.A. Geist und E. Ng, ’Task Scheduling for Parallel Sparse Cholesky Factorization’, in: Internat. J. Parallel Programming, 18 (1989), S.291–314.
A. George, M.T. Heath, J.W-H Liu und E. Ng, ’Sparse Cholesky Factorization On A Local-Memory Multiprocessor’, in: SIAM J. Sci. Stat. Comput., Vol.9, No.2, März 1988, S.327–340.
M.T. Heath, E. Ng, B.W. Peyton, ’Parallel algorithms for sparse linear systems’, in: SIAM Review, Vol.33, Nr.3, S.420–460.
J.W-H Liu, ’The Role Of Elimination Tree In Sparse Factorization’, in: SIAM J. Matrix Anal. Appl., Vol.11, No.1, Januar 1990, S.134–172.
J.W-H Liu, ’The Multifrontal Method for Sparse Matrix Solution: Theory and Practice’, in: SIAM Review, Vol.34, No.1, März 1992, S.82–109.
K.A. McShane, C.L. Monma und D.F. Shanno, ’An Implementation of a Primal-Dual Interior Point Method for Linear Programming’, in: ORSA Journal of Computing, Vol.1, No.2, Frühjahr 1989, S.70–83.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 1993 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Bachem, A., Strietzel, M. (1993). Eine parallele Implementation des Karmarkar—Verfahrens. In: Baumann, M., Grebe, R. (eds) Parallele Datenverarbeitung mit dem Transputer. Informatik aktuell.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-78123-0_25
Download citation
DOI: https://doi.org/10.1007/978-3-642-78123-0_25
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-56534-5
Online ISBN: 978-3-642-78123-0
eBook Packages: Springer Book Archive